Title Cause of error Check point & Normal condition
Check Point
CH 32
1. Check the installation conditions for over loads.
2. Check if the SVC valve is open.
3. Check for leakage of refrigerant.
CH 40
1. If the resistance of the sensor is only , the check Is
possible.
2 If the error occurs again after the reset , change the
PCB.
CH 33
1. Check the installation conditions for over loads.
2. Check if the SVC valve is open.
3. Check for leakage of refrigerant.
4. Check the constant compressor. (same with CH21)
